4. Technological Advances in Crossing Roads: From Manual to Automated Systems

The 20th century saw rapid technological progress in traffic management. Traffic lights, first introduced in the 1910s, became a universal method to regulate vehicle and pedestrian flow. Pedestrian buttons allowed individuals to request crossing signals, improving safety and efficiency.

Modern systems incorporate sensors and cameras that detect vehicle and pedestrian presence, automatically adjusting signals to minimize wait times and accidents. 9. Non-Obvious Perspectives: Ethical and Environmental Considerations of Road Crossings

Designing crossings raises ethical questions about the impact on wildlife and ecosystems. Creating barriers or tunnels can disrupt animal migration, while poorly planned roads lead to habitat fragmentation. Balancing human safety with ecological preservation remains a significant challenge.

Environmental concerns also include pollution and noise, which affect both urban and rural environments. Ethical considerations demand innovative solutions that mitigate harm, such as wildlife corridors or eco-bridges, ensuring harmonious coexistence between development and nature.
